A New Era in Surgery: The Rise of Minimally Invasive Approaches

The modern intervention suite is worlds apart from the major incisions and lengthy inpatient stays that marked surgical procedures a century ago.

Surgeons today increasingly rely on techniques that minimize tissue disruption and preserve the natural anatomy of the body.

Fundamental to these breakthroughs are manifested as micro-invasive and muscle-protecting procedures.

The concept of micro-invasive surgery involves approaches that incorporate small incisions, advanced instruments, and high-definition visualization for accessing and treating internal conditions while sparing adjacent tissues.

On the other hand, muscle-sparing surgery prioritizes the conservation of muscle structure in operations traditionally involving wide muscle incisions.

Both methods are part of a broader movement toward reducing patient morbidity, pain, and recovery time.

Historical Perspectives: From Open Surgery to Tissue Preservation

Surgical practices have long been dictated by necessity and available technology.

Before the breakthrough of current imaging and specialized instrumentation, physicians had little choice but to execute large open incisions to ensure adequate exposure and reach the target site.

Though these methods were essential for saving lives, they customarily resulted in significant postoperative discomfort, extended healing periods, and risks like infections or continuous muscle weakness.

This shift commenced with the advent of laparoscopic surgery in the late 1900s—a minimally invasive approach enabling internal viewing through the insertion of a small camera via tiny incisions.

As technology advanced, surgeons began to appreciate that preserving muscle integrity during procedures could offer even greater benefits.

Muscle-sparing techniques, initially developed in orthopedics and cardiovascular surgery, soon found applications in abdominal, gynecological, and oncological procedures, among others.

Dr. Eleanor Matthews , an innovator in minimally invasive procedures at a leading teaching hospital, remembers: “We realized that every incision we made, every muscle we cut, had a lasting impact on our patients. The drive to improve quality of life post-surgery has pushed us to continually refine our methods.”

This transition to less traumatic procedures not only represents a technical achievement but also a profound change in the philosophy of surgical care.

Scientific Insights into the Methods

Micro-Invasive Surgery: Precision Through Technology
Fundamental to micro-invasive procedures is the commitment to precision.

Surgeons use an array of high-tech tools—from endoscopes and robotic-assisted devices to specialized microscopes—to navigate the human body through minuscule openings.

These instruments provide enhanced magnification and illumination, enabling the precise identification and treatment of the target area without extensive tissue damage.

A notable innovation has been the assimilation of robotic-assisted technology into surgical systems.

These platforms allow surgeons to operate with unprecedented steadiness and accuracy, filtering out natural hand tremors and translating subtle movements into fine, controlled actions.

For procedures such as prostatectomies and heart surgeries, such precision directly enhances patient outcomes.

Cardiothoracic Operations: Minimizing Cardiac Impact

Heart and thoracic surgeries have greatly prospered from micro-invasive methods.

Procedures such as valve repairs and coronary artery bypass grafting (CABG) have traditionally required large incisions and extensive dissection of muscle tissue.

Today, surgeons increasingly employ minimally invasive techniques that use small incisions and specialized instruments to access the heart and surrounding structures.

The integration of robotic-assisted systems into cardiothoracic procedures has further perfected these techniques.

Often, the robotic platform supplies the precision needed to execute gentle maneuvers on the beating heart, reducing complication probabilities and accelerating recovery.

A comparative study published in the Annals of Thoracic Surgery found that patients undergoing minimally invasive valve repairs had lower rates of postoperative atrial fibrillation and shorter hospital stays compared to those who underwent conventional surgery.

General and Gynecologic Surgery: Enhancing Patient Outcomes.

In the realm of general and gynecologic surgery, micro-invasive techniques have transformed procedures such as gallbladder removals, hernia repairs, and hysterectomies.

The shift toward smaller incisions and muscle preservation not only reduces the visible scarring but also minimizes postoperative discomfort and the potential for complications.

As an instance, laparoscopic cholecystectomy—performed through small incisions for gallbladder removal—has become widely recognized as the standard of care.

Patients enjoy abbreviated recovery periods and the capability to quickly return to normal activities following the procedure.

Within gynecologic surgery, muscle-preserving methods have played a crucial role in enhancing outcomes for women undergoing intricate procedures like myomectomies or pelvic floor reconstructions.

Clinical outcomes reviewed in a top-tier medical journal indicated that minimally invasive gynecologic surgeries are associated with diminished infection and blood loss, and better cosmetic results.

These improvements not only enhance patient satisfaction but also contribute to better overall health outcomes.

Weighing the Benefits and Challenges.

Benefits That Extend Beyond the Operating Room.

The gains from minimally invasive and muscle-sparing approaches extend far beyond the technical realm of surgery.

For patients, the benefits are tangible and life-changing.

Reduced pain, minimized scarring, and faster recovery times translate directly into an improved quality of life.

Frequently, individuals can get back to work and normal activities in a matter of days instead of weeks, which is crucial in our rapidly evolving world.

From a broader healthcare perspective, these techniques help lower hospital costs by reducing the length of hospital stays and the need for postoperative care.

Additionally, lower complication rates lead to fewer readmissions, a crucial benefit for both healthcare providers and insurers.

The psychological benefits should not be underestimated.

Knowing that a procedure can be performed with minimal impact on one’s body provides reassurance and reduces preoperative anxiety.

This factor is vital for patients scheduled for major surgeries, as a calm, optimistic outlook can enhance overall recovery and outcomes.

Obstacles and Limitations: A Pragmatic View.

Despite the numerous advantages, micro-invasive and muscle-sparing techniques are not without challenges.

One significant limitation is the steep learning curve associated with these advanced methods.

Surgeons need to complete comprehensive training and acquire significant experience to perform these techniques as proficiently as traditional methods.

Due to the considerable initial investment in technology and training, these techniques may be less accessible in resource-limited environments.

Moreover, not all patients are ideal candidates for these approaches.

In cases where extensive disease or anatomical complexities are present, traditional open surgery may still be the safest and most effective option.

Surgeons must carefully assess each case, balancing the potential benefits of minimally invasive techniques against the specific needs of the patient.

Technical limitations also play a role.

Even with state-of-the-art equipment, there can be instances where the operative field is limited, or unexpected complications arise, necessitating conversion to an open procedure.

These relatively infrequent instances underscore the need for a well-prepared, adaptable surgical team capable of managing changing conditions.

The Future of Surgery: Trends and Innovations.

Integrating Artificial Intelligence and Robotic Technologies.

While current techniques in micro-invasive and muscle-sparing surgery have already made a significant impact, future progress promises even more dramatic changes.

The integration of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ning into surgical systems is poised to further enhance precision and efficiency.

These innovations can rapidly process enormous volumes of data in real time, offering predictive insights that may enhance surgical decision-making.

For instance, AI-powered imaging solutions are being developed to automatically underscore essential anatomical structures, thereby diminishing the risk of accidental injury.

Robotic platforms are also evolving, with next-generation systems offering even finer control and enhanced haptic feedback, which allows surgeons to "feel" the tissue they are operating on—a feature that traditional laparoscopic instruments lack.

Expanding the Boundaries of Minimally Invasive Surgery.

Research and development in tissue engineering and regenerative medicine are anticipated to intersect with forward-thinking surgical innovations.

Researchers are exploring strategies that not only diminish tissue damage but also enhance rapid and natural recovery.

This encompasses the application of bioengineered scaffolds designed to support tissue regeneration and minimize scar formation post-surgery.

Furthermore, as imaging and sensor systems evolve, there is potential for surgeons to perform procedures with even less invasiveness than currently possible.

Innovations such as nanorobots and miniature, implantable devices could one day allow for targeted therapy and diagnostics at a cellular level, ushering in a new era of truly personalized medicine.
